CVE-2026-21345
Adobe Substance 3D Stager vulnerability analysis and mitigation

Overview

CVE-2026-21345 is an out-of-bounds read vulnerability in Adobe Substance 3D Stager that can allow an attacker to execute arbitrary code in the context of the current user. It affects Substance 3D Stager versions 3.1.6 and earlier, with version 3.1.7 introduced as the fix. The vulnerability was disclosed and patched on February 10, 2026, as part of Adobe's February 2026 security update (APSB26-20). It carries a CVSS v3.1 base score of 7.8 (High) (Adobe Advisory).

Technical details

The vulnerability is classified as CWE-125 (Out-of-bounds Read) and is triggered during the parsing of a specially crafted file. When a malicious file is opened, the application reads past the end of an allocated memory structure, which can be leveraged to achieve arbitrary code execution. Exploitation requires local access and user interaction — specifically, a victim must be socially engineered into opening a malicious file. The attack vector is local with no privileges required (Adobe Advisory).

Impact

Successful exploitation allows an attacker to execute arbitrary code with the privileges of the currently logged-in user, resulting in high confidentiality, integrity, and availability impact on the affected system. An attacker could use this foothold to access sensitive files, install malware, or pivot to other systems accessible by the compromised user account. The scope is limited to the affected host, as the vulnerability does not inherently enable cross-system propagation (Adobe Advisory).

Exploitation steps

  1. Craft a malicious file: Create a specially crafted file (e.g., a 3D scene or project file supported by Substance 3D Stager) that triggers an out-of-bounds read during parsing.
  2. Deliver the file: Distribute the malicious file to the target via phishing email, malicious download link, or other social engineering methods.
  3. Induce user interaction: Convince the victim to open the malicious file using Substance 3D Stager version 3.1.6 or earlier.
  4. Trigger the vulnerability: Upon file parsing, the application reads past the end of an allocated memory buffer (CWE-125), potentially exposing memory contents or corrupting adjacent memory.
  5. Achieve code execution: Leverage the out-of-bounds read to execute arbitrary code in the context of the current user, enabling installation of malware, data exfiltration, or further lateral movement (Adobe Advisory).

Indicators of compromise

  • File System: Unexpected or unfamiliar 3D project/scene files received via email or downloaded from untrusted sources; new or modified files in Substance 3D Stager working directories.
  • Process: Unusual child processes spawned by the Substance 3D Stager process (e.g., cmd.exe, powershell.exe, bash, curl, wget); unexpected network connections initiated by the application.
  • Logs: Application crash logs or error reports from Substance 3D Stager referencing memory access violations or out-of-bounds read errors; Windows Event Logs showing application faults tied to the Stager executable.

Mitigation and workarounds

Adobe has released Substance 3D Stager version 3.1.7 to address this vulnerability, and upgrading to this version or later is the recommended remediation (Adobe Advisory). As an interim measure, users should be educated to avoid opening 3D project files from untrusted or unknown sources. Organizations may also consider restricting the use of Substance 3D Stager to trusted file sources through endpoint controls or application allowlisting until patching is complete.

Community reactions

The Center for Internet Security (CIS) published an advisory noting that multiple Adobe vulnerabilities patched in February 2026, including this one, could allow for arbitrary code execution (CIS Advisory). Tenable released a Nessus detection plugin (ID 298882) for this vulnerability. Coverage was also noted in security aggregators such as BeyondMachines and Fortress SRM as part of broader February 2026 patch roundups.
